Voting underway in 24 municipalities

The voting in the first phase elections to 24 municipalities has begun on Monday morning.

Because of the Covid-19 situation, the election will be held in four phases.

Electronic Voting Machines (EVM) are being used in the elections which started at 8:00am and will continue till 4:00pm without any break.

According to EC, a total of 6.25 lakh voters are expected to cast their votes at those 24 municipalities in 22 districts, according to the EC.

A total of 93 mayor aspirants are contesting for the 24 posts, while 801 councillor candidates for 216 posts and 266 candidates for 72 women's reserve seats, as per the EC.

As usual, the main battle is expected to be between the candidates of Awami League and BNP. However candidates of Jatiya Party, Islami Andolan Bangladesh and Jatiya Ganatantrik Party are also eyeing for the posts of mayor in the municipal areas.

The 24 municipalities are: Panchagarh of Panchagarh, Pirganj of Thakurgaon, Phulbari of Dinajpur, Badarganj of Rangpur, Kurigram of Kurigram, Puthia and Katakhali of Rajshahi, Shahjadpur of Sirajganj, Chatmohor of Pabna, Kokhsha of Kushtia, Chuadanga of Chuadanga, Chalna of Khulna, Betagi of Barguna, Kuakata of Patuakhali, Ujirpur and Bakerganj of Barishal, Gafargoan of Mymensingh, Madan of Netrakona, Dhamrai of Dhaka, Dirai of Sunanganj, Borolekha of Moulvibazar, Sayestaganj of Habiganj, and Sitakunda of Chhattogram.

Executive and judicial magistrates along with the members of different law enforcement agencies, including BGB, RAB, police and Ansar, are monitoring the elections.

The second phase elections to 61 municipalities will be held on Jan 16. EVM will be used in 29 municipalities while ballot voting will be held in the remaining 32 municipalities.

According to the latest schedule, the third phase elections will be held on Jan 30 in 64 municipalities. Municipalities, which will be eligible for polls by February, will witness a fourth round of voting.
